Transaction 5843dc7769ca17031202d54dec61d664657a664a31d96a1bb68d58211abc2834

1 Input
2 Outputs
  • 5843dc7769ca17031202d54dec61d664657a664a31d96a1bb68d58211abc2834:0
  • value  352967
    address  32gHwGHyDDj5eF3JYxzVzXU87qx4TvRi5y
  • 5843dc7769ca17031202d54dec61d664657a664a31d96a1bb68d58211abc2834:1
  • value  624426
    address  1DRFt4YSjxyZbfQ7NPttDkciTkSWQ4sp26